Output 37d32ea8c74ae34f9a1ce417c67abf494eace39394da2d1746108f123e053fe2:0

value
635519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 342d75c6db8f0ad2612d70b1a708f07bb033d34e OP_EQUAL
address
36SuX946DkQvpUc5zksQzyimWMiAVrSstW
transaction
37d32ea8c74ae34f9a1ce417c67abf494eace39394da2d1746108f123e053fe2
confirmations
331880
spent
true